小编fun*_*fly的帖子

包装器内两个跨距之一的文本溢出省略号

我有省略号的问题.这是我的HTML:

<div id="wrapper">
    <span id="firstText">This text should be effected by ellipsis</span>
    <span id="lastText">this text should not change size</span>
</div>
Run Code Online (Sandbox Code Playgroud)

有没有办法用纯css做到这一点?这是我尝试过的:

#firstText
{
    overflow: hidden;
    white-space:nowrap;
    text-overflow:ellipsis;
}

#lastText
{
    white-space:nowrap;
    overflow:visible;   
}
Run Code Online (Sandbox Code Playgroud)

这是如何显示:

本文应以省略号的形式实施

虽然这是我想要的结果:

这个文本应该是......这个文本不应该改变大小

html css

57
推荐指数
3
解决办法
6万
查看次数

如何将大型AngularJS项目拆分为模块

我来自Backbone和JavascriptMVC的世界.但我真的很想转而使用AngularJS.到目前为止,我有一个大问题让我无法转换.

我创建单页应用程序.让我们假装它包含一个标签模块,一个文件上传模块和一个文件列表模块.

我在Backbone中要做的是,我将每个模块拆分为独立模块,使用自己的视图模板,viewcontroller等.这样,我就可以在我的应用程序中使用该模块的几个位置.模块除了自身以外不了解任何其他内容.

如何在AngularJS中处理这个问题?是否可以为每个模块创建一个angular.module(例如标签模块)?

我觉得他们告诉如何在他们的文档中创建模块中的许多控制器.但这听起来并不像我需要的那样.或者我在这里误解了一些主要概念?

编辑:我做了更多的研究.它看起来像指令是我正在寻找的.虽然AngularJS中的模块代表整个Web应用程序.因此,名称'组件'和'模块'的混合使我感到困惑.

我现在正走在正确的道路上吗?

angularjs

9
推荐指数
1
解决办法
3724
查看次数

Docker 在 Mac 上卡在“Docker Desktop 正在启动...”

我无法在我的 Mac(Intel)上启动 Docker。它只是卡在 Docker Desktop 启动中......以下是我尝试过的操作:

  • 使用桌面安装程序运行
  • 使用brew安装程序运行(brew install --cask docker)
  • 在调试菜单中:
    • 清理/清除数据
    • 重置为出厂默认设置

尝试在终端中运行 docker ps 显示:

Error response from daemon: dial unix docker.raw.sock: connect: no such file or directory
Run Code Online (Sandbox Code Playgroud)

如果我退出docker,则com.docker.vmnetd需要手动杀死该进程。

这个问题是在 4.5.0 版本左右开始的,现在我在 4.12.0 版本上,仍然是同样的问题。如果我降级到较早的版本(使用以前的 UI),它就可以工作。但过了一段时间,Docker 强制自己更新,这让我又遇到了同样的问题。

有谁知道我可以尝试什么?

docker docker-desktop

7
推荐指数
0
解决办法
8629
查看次数

使用纯 CSS 制作类似 Chrome 的选项卡大小调整

我正在尝试创建调整大小的选项卡,其大小与 Chrome 选项卡的做法类似。但我不确定如何以及是否可以在没有 JavaScript 的情况下做到这一点。

我不关心浏览器支持,我只想看看是否可以用纯html和css/css3来完成。

这是规格:

  • 选项卡永远不会比其中的文本宽
  • 当最右边的选项卡在调整大小时到达窗口的右侧时,选项卡应该开始缩小(理想情况是最宽的选项卡首先发生这种情况)
  • 活动选项卡永远不应该缩小
  • 随着选项卡缩小,文本应通过省略号隐藏
  • 选项卡将停止在我设置的最小宽度处(因此它们不能达到零宽度)。

这可以用类似 display: box; 的东西来做吗?和盒子柔性:1;也许属性?我还没有成功。我已经用 JavaScript 做到了。但性能没有我想要的那么好(这是一个很大的 wep 应用程序)。

那么,有 CSS 大神支持吗?如果有一种方法可以在非常有限地使用 JavaScript 的情况下做到这一点,我也很感兴趣。

谢谢大家!

css

5
推荐指数
1
解决办法
3558
查看次数

标签 统计

css ×2

angularjs ×1

docker ×1

docker-desktop ×1

html ×1